Second World Health Tourism Congress – Lemesos, Cyprus, March 2007
The Second Annual World Health Tourism Congress will be held in Cyprus, at the Le Meridien Limassol Spa and Resort from March 23rd to the 26th 2007. The Congress is sponsored and supported by the Cyprus Tourism Organization as part of its actions to develop and promote Health Tourism in Cyprus. "Aura Events", an Events Organizer based in Dubai, U.A.E., has just hosted the First Annual World Health Tourism Congress in the City of Wiesbaden Germany from May 27 to May 29 2006. Cyprus won the bid to host the 2007 Congress.

The World Health Tourism Congress is an Executive Congress selectively targeting Corporate Buyers (instead of individual consumers) - and focuses on Sales (instead of marketing and branding). The Congress is designed to bring the willing and empowered buyer of Health Tourism Services in direct and personal contact with the provider of Health Tourism Services – and to encourage ‘”Deals and Agreements”. The Buyer (who is a confirmed decision maker with a mandate to buy) comes to see what is available, express his needs and consider offerings. The Provider comes to showcase and offer his services to the willing and empowered decision-maker.
At the First Annual Congress, the Organizers hosted 150 qualified Corporate Buyers from the GCC / Gulf Area (60%), Africa, Europe, North America and Asia. Buyers came to consider the offerings of 55 Providers of Health Tourism Services [e.g., private clinics and hospitals, hotels with spa facilities], from Asia, the Middle East, South Africa and Europe.
The format of the event is based on pre-scheduled one-to-one meetings with selected Buyers. In addition, there are a few workshops occurring, specifically developed for the Congress and presented by experts with a deep knowledge and understanding of Health Tourism. Ample informal networking opportunities are also provided during the several coffee breaks and social events (cocktail receptions, luncheons and Gala Dinner).
